2:11 PM ET OWINGS MILLS, Md. — There is no mystery surrounding the Baltimore Ravens‘ starting quarterback position this week. Lamar Jackson will make his second NFL start Sunday against the Oakland Raiders, coach John Harbaugh announced Friday. 1:31 PM ET New York Jets quarterback Sam Darnold will sit for the second straight game with a foot injury, coach Todd Bowles confirmed Friday. Hosts Ghana will play no further part in the 2018 Africa Women Cup of Nations after being held 1-1 by Cameroon in their final Group A game at the Accra Sports Stadium. The Black Queens were pipped in the final standings by Mali, who twice came back from behind to beat Algeria 3-2 to progress.
